Go to Active Directory Domains and trusts.
First right-click all the domains and select "raise domain functional level".
Afterwards you can right-click Active Directory Domains and Trusts and selec "raise forest functional level".
It is very important first to raise ALL the domains to 2003...

In IIS you have an option to specify host headers. This lets you answer your webserver to a request from e.g. www.domain1.com to port 80 for instance, and on the 2nd website you configure the host header with www.domain2.com and port 1080.

I suggest first you set up your new DHCP.
Then on the old DHCP you take a short lease time and un-authorize and after a day or two (depending on your configuration) you can take it down.
I think there is a way to back up DHCP settings but I haven't done that either before.

Why would you transfer all your DHCP records? I would just reconfigure the new DHCP with the appropriate options (normally it isn't that much work) and then shut down the old DHCP server.

In DNS you convert fully qualified domain names (e.g. computer.department.company.com) to an IP - or vice versa.
WINS uses the same names as NetBIOS names and converts them to an IP address (thus as in the example it just links "computer" to an IP).

Hmm, apparently you have misconfigured your firewall. You say in your 1st post: "I have ADSL and my port 25 is opened on my router pointing to my DNS server."
You have to open port 25 and let it point to your mail server, not your DNS server.
